Output e270785f4245d5677801f65d51cf53d7e4d800412a662b35e415c4e54dc5e5d6:0

value
83344
script pubkey
OP_0 OP_PUSHBYTES_20 d068efffc39e4f287595aefb787cf548449b3863
address
bc1q6p5wll7rne8jsav44mahsl84fpzfkwrrwhx3k8
transaction
e270785f4245d5677801f65d51cf53d7e4d800412a662b35e415c4e54dc5e5d6
confirmations
300589
spent
true